Keanu Reeves makes his first ever directorial debut in Man Of Tai Chi. The story is about Donaka Mark played by Reeves himself who follows the spiritual journey of a young martial artist played by Tiger Chen, whose unparalleled Tai Chi skills land him in a highly lucrative underworld fight club.

As the fights become more dangerous, so does his will to survive. This is a solid film and a promising comeback from Keanu Reeves since I have been waiting for a movie of his for years. The "Fight Club"-style modern martial arts action scenes were the most intense in recent years of martial arts history.

But let's just hoe he doesn't stray away too much from acting to be honest. Man of Tai Chi gets a solid 10/10.
